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17321 8572 43038374 3368844
612 832486439
612 832486439
735550911 212355 65504836117
All about undefined
Interested in learning more?
612 832486439
735550911 212355 65504836117
See more
0409692507 938163 6054037
2011 617 454
See more
824916796 39
1197494 39559376073 46 4629 95489773330
See more